Core Features
Plunger-Actuated Mechanical Sensing: Functions as a single-pole, double-throw (SPDT) basic limit switch optimized for simple position detection in light-to-medium industrial applications. It uses a spring-loaded, non-roller plunger with a reinforced tip—designed to trigger electrical contact actuation when pressed by moving parts (e.g., machine slides, workpieces, or door panels). This makes it ideal for low-to-moderate cycle tasks like end-of-travel confirmation for small CNC axes, presence detection for assembly line components, or basic enclosure door monitoring.
Standard Industrial Electrical Ratings: Rated for AC 230V (50/60Hz) and DC 24V, with a maximum switching current of 5A (resistive load) and 2A (inductive load). The SPDT configuration (1 normally open/NO + 1 normally closed/NC contact) supports flexible control logic—e.g., using the NO contact to signal “position reached” and the NC contact to interrupt a “standby” circuit. This enables direct integration with PLCs (e.g., Siemens S7-1200), indicator lights, or small relays without requiring auxiliary power conditioning.
Durable Design for General Industrial Use: Constructed with an impact-resistant thermoplastic (ABS) housing (UL94 V-0 flame-retardant rating) and a zinc-plated steel plunger. The housing includes a integrated gasket to enhance dust and moisture resistance, while the plunger’s corrosion-resistant coating prevents rusting in humid or oily environments. The switch meets IP65 protection (IEC 60529), safeguarding against low-pressure water jets and dust ingress—suitable for non-washdown settings like manufacturing floors, material handling stations, or small machine enclosures.
Precise Actuation & Reliable Reset: The plunger features a 7mm stroke length and a consistent return spring force (3.8N actuation force), ensuring ±0.1mm position tolerance for repeatable feedback. The plunger’s rounded tip minimizes damage to delicate contacted parts (e.g., painted surfaces, plastic housings) while preventing jamming from debris buildup—extending both the switch’s lifespan and the integrity of the machinery it monitors.
Simplified Installation & Mounting Flexibility: Supports surface mounting via integrated M4 screw holes, with a compact, low-profile design that fits in tight spaces (e.g., machine frames, conveyor side rails, or control panel enclosures). The terminal block is clearly labeled (NO/NC/Common) for intuitive wiring, accepting 0.5–1.5mm² wires—reducing installation time and minimizing wiring errors for technicians.
Global Compliance for Basic Applications: Meets essential industrial standards including IEC 60947-5-1 (limit switches), UL 508, and CSA C22.2 No. 14, ensuring compatibility with global electrical systems. It complies with basic machinery safety guidelines (EN ISO 13849-1, Category 1) for non-safety-critical position monitoring, making it a cost-effective choice for standard industrial use cases.
Typical Applications
The Siemens Switch 3SE3000-8AV00 is engineered for simple, reliable position sensing in light-to-medium industrial environments, with core use cases including:
Small Machine Slide End-Stop Control: Installed at the travel limits of compact CNC linear slides (e.g., benchtop milling machines, 3D printer X/Y axes, or small lathes). When the slide reaches its end position, it presses the plunger, activating the NC contact to cut power to the slide motor and the NO contact to trigger an “overtravel” indicator—preventing mechanical damage to the slide, tooling, or workpiece.
Assembly Line Component Presence Detection: Deployed in electronic or mechanical assembly lines (e.g., PCB insertion, connector mating, or fastener installation) to verify that components are in place before processing. If a component is missing, it fails to actuate the plunger, keeping the NC contact closed to pause the machine—reducing defective parts and improving production quality.
Conveyor Line Product Positioning: Mounted along lightweight conveyors (e.g., for packaging inserts, small electronic parts, or pharmaceutical vials) to align products before downstream processes (e.g., labeling, sealing). As a product passes, it presses the plunger, signaling the conveyor controller to adjust speed or trigger a stop—ensuring precise product alignment.
Benchtop Equipment Cycle Confirmation: Used in benchtop tools (e.g., small injection molders, heat sealers, or manual press machines) to confirm the completion of a work cycle. When the tool’s moving component (e.g., mold clamp, sealer bar) reaches its fully extended position, it actuates the plunger, closing the NO contact to signal the operator (via an LED) or trigger a PLC to initiate cooling or part ejection.
Small Enclosure Door Monitoring: Mounted on the access doors of small machine enclosures (e.g., sensor housings, control boxes, or benchtop equipment) to confirm that doors are fully closed during operation. If the door is opened, the plunger resets, opening the NO contact to pause the machine—preventing accidental contact with moving parts inside the enclosure.
